Wholesale Charity
- Bill Gates prioritizes measurable impact in his philanthropy, focusing on areas where he can optimize results.
- This approach, while not always inspiring, allows him to maximize the effectiveness of his resources.
Bill Gates's Reading Habits
- Bill Gates's voracious reading and high retention are key to his success.
- He may prefer physical books to better compartmentalize and recall vast amounts of information.
